A chemist has isolated a new natural product and determined its molecular formula to be C24H40O4. In hydrogenation experiments the chemist found that each mole of the natural product reacted with two moles of H2. How many rings are present in the structure of the new natural product?

Flotation Costs

Expenses incurred by a company in issuing new securities, including underwriting fees, legal costs, and registration fees.

Debt/Equity Ratio

The ratio that outlines the distribution of financing between debt and equity for company assets.

Cost of Equity

The rate of return that shareholders require on their investment in a company, influencing how much a company should pay to finance its equity.

Pre-Tax Cost of Debt

The rate of return that a company pays on its debt before taking into account taxes.
